Can I refreeze defrosted Bolognese?

The answer is yes. But pay attention to the way you thaw and, conversely, the way you freeze. Most foods previously frozen, thawed and then cooked can be refrozen as long as they have not been sitting at room temperature for more than two hours .

Can I freeze Bolognese sauce twice?

Refreezing. If you have frozen minced beef in your freezer and you defrost it, as long as you have cooked it you can re-freeze it again . For example, defrost your minced beef, make it into a cooked Bolognese sauce, you can then refreeze the Bolognese sauce.

Why is it bad to thaw and refreeze meat?

When you freeze, thaw, and refreeze an item, the second thaw will break down even more cells, leaching out moisture and changing the integrity of the product . The other enemy is bacteria. Frozen and thawed food will develop harmful bacteria faster than fresh.

Can you refreeze something that has been defrosted?

When is it safe to refreeze food? You can safely refreeze frozen food that has thawed —raw or cooked, although there may be a loss of quality due to the moisture lost through thawing. To safely refreeze, the thawed product must have been kept cold at 40 degrees or below for no more than 3-4 days.

How long is spaghetti sauce with meat good for in the fridge?

MEAT SAUCE, (INCLUDING BOLOGNESE SAUCE) – COOKED, HOMEMADE

Properly stored, cooked meat sauce will last for 3 to 4 days in the refrigerator. To further extend the shelf life of cooked meat sauce, freeze it; freeze in covered airtight containers or heavy-duty freezer bags.

Can you refreeze cooked meatballs in sauce?

The sauce with meatballs (but without any pasta) should freeze without problems . After cooking, cool and chill the meatballs and sauce as quickly as possible (and within 2 hours of making) and then transfer to airtight containers and freeze for up to 3 months.

Does thawed food contain bacteria?

Foods are safe indefinitely while frozen; however, as soon as food begins to defrost and become warmer than 40°F, any bacteria that may have been present before freezing can begin to multiply .

Can I refreeze cooked lasagna?

A well-made lasagna can usually be thawed and refrozen once without any especially bad effects , but after that you'll begin to notice some undesirable changes. The repeated freezing can make the noodles soft and mushy, and ingredients such as ricotta, cottage cheese and spinach can ooze moisture into the dish.

Can refreezing food cause food poisoning?

Refreezing food is not dangerous , the danger is that food can spoil before it's refrozen or after it's thawed again but before being cooked and eaten. Freezing food does not kill bacteria, so once thawed bacteria continues to multiple at the same exponential rate it was multiplying at before being frozen.

How do you freeze cooked meat sauce?

  1. Prepare Bolognese Sauce recipe according to instructions.
  2. Let sauce cool completely.
  3. Transfer sauce to freezer safe airtight containers or freezer bags.
  4. Squeeze out any excess air, seal and label.
  5. Freeze for up to 3 months.
  6. When ready to use, let Bolognese Sauce thaw in the refrigerator overnight.
